A GRE score is not required unless your GPA is below 2.5. A new rule from the Texas Education Agency states, “An applicant who does not meet the minimum GPA requirement of 2.5 and is seeking Principal as Instructional Leader certification must perform at or above a score equivalent to a 2.5 GPA on the Verbal Reasoning, Quantitative Reasoning, and Analytic Writing sections of the GRE® (Graduate Record Examinations) revised General Test.”
Subject to the approval of the department advisor and the Toulouse Graduate School, up to 6 semester hours of graduate work completed elsewhere may be applied.
I understand that I must have a Teaching Certificate and at least two years of teaching experience in an EC-12 accredited school as the teacher of record in order to earn a Principal as Instructional Leader. (Student teaching, substitute teaching, or university teaching cannot be applied toward these two years). I understand I must submit a copy of my Teacher Service Record to the College of Education’s Certification Officer to verify the state’s minimum required classroom teaching experience has been met. If I qualify for the principal certificate, I understand I must two-semester practicum in an accredited Texas school with a supervisor who holds an administrative certificate.
